How Many Discoid Roaches Should I Feed My Fire-Bellied Toad?

By All Angles Creatures4 min read

Direct Answer: Small Nymphs Only for Fire-Bellied Toads

Fire-bellied toads can and do eat discoid roaches, but only small nymphs, and in small quantities per feeding. An adult fire-bellied toad typically eats 2 to 4 small discoid roach nymphs (roughly 1/4 to 3/8 inch) per feeding session, 3 to 4 times per week. Juveniles need 1 to 2 small nymphs at the same frequency. Never offer medium or larger roaches to fire-bellied toads; their small gape (mouth width) makes these oversized and potentially dangerous. The key with this species is respecting their small body size and matching prey carefully. Fire-bellied toads are unusual among amphibians in being active diurnal foragers—they hunt during the day rather than waiting at night—which means feeding sessions offer excellent opportunity for direct observation and portion control.

Natural Range and Habitat

Fire-bellied toads (genus Bombina) are endemic to East Asia, with different species distributed across China, Japan, and adjacent regions. The most common in the pet trade is the Oriental fire-bellied toad (Bombina orientalis), native to Korea, northeastern China, and eastern Russia. These small toads inhabit semi-aquatic environments: marshes, rice paddies, swamps, shallow ponds, and adjacent grasslands where water is never far away but terrestrial habitat is readily accessible.

Fire-bellied toads are adapted to temperate climates with distinct seasons. In the wild, they experience cooler winters and warmer breeding seasons—unlike the tropical species most beginner keepers encounter. The semi-aquatic lifestyle means they're equally at home in shallow water and on wet terrestrial substrate. Water clarity and vegetation matter—they use cover to hide from predators and to ambush prey.

The climate is cool by tropical standards: 65–75°F most of the year, with seasonal variation. Humidity is high near water, and the toads rarely move far from moisture. This semi-aquatic, cool-climate niche shaped everything about their physiology and behavior.

Natural Diet and Hunting Behavior: The Diurnal Forager

Fire-bellied toads are one of the most unusual amphibians in the pet hobby: they are active diurnal hunters rather than sit-and-wait nocturnal ambush predators. In the wild, fire-bellied toads actively move through marshes and shallow water during daylight, visually hunting for invertebrates. This is not typical amphibian behavior; most frogs and toads are crepuscular or nocturnal. Fire-bellied toads bucked that trend.

Their natural diet consists of small arthropods: aquatic insects, small terrestrial insects, tiny crustaceans, and other small invertebrates they encounter while foraging. They're not picky hunters—they'll consume whatever small prey is available in their semi-aquatic habitat. The diet is high-protein but modest in caloric volume per feeding because the prey items are small and the toads themselves are small.

The key behavioral aspect is the active foraging strategy. Fire-bellied toads don't sit waiting for prey to come to them. They patrol the margins of water, hunt on terrestrial substrate, and strike at moving prey items. This makes them naturally responsive to active feedings in captivity. An offered roach is more likely to trigger a feeding response because the toad is already in active-hunting mode when prey appears.

The warning coloration—a bright red or orange belly with bold black markings—is tied to mild toxins in the skin. When threatened, fire-bellied toads flip to expose this coloration as a warning to predators: "I'm toxic, leave me alone." The toxins are mild by amphibian standards (nothing like poison dart frogs), but they're enough to deter many predators. This defense strategy means captive fire-bellied toads are relatively unafraid of handling compared to other amphibians, though stress should still be minimized.

Feeding Chart by Life Stage

Life Stage Roach Count Roach Size Feeding Frequency
Juveniles (0–6 months) 1–2 roaches Small nymphs (1/4–3/8") 4–5 times per week
Young Adults (6–18 months) 2–3 roaches Small nymphs (1/4–3/8") 3–4 times per week
Mature Adults (18+ months) 2–4 roaches Small nymphs (1/4–3/8") 3–4 times per week

These quantities reflect the fire-bellied toad's small size and the active-foraging, relatively high-metabolism lifestyle. Fire-bellied toads need more frequent feeding than larger, more sedentary species, but portions remain small because the animals are small. Never upgrade to medium roaches; small nymphs are the maximum size appropriate for this species.

Critical Roach Sizing for Fire-Bellied Toads

Size discipline is non-negotiable with fire-bellied toads. These are genuinely small amphibians—adults typically measure 1 to 2 inches in length. Their gape is correspondingly small. A small discoid roach nymph at 1/4 to 3/8 inch is appropriate; anything larger is risky. Medium nymphs (1/2 to 3/4 inch) are too large, and adult roaches are completely oversized.

Oversized prey can cause impaction (blockage of the digestive tract), injury to the mouth or throat, and severe stress. A fire-bellied toad that attempts to consume a roach too large for its gape might succeed partially and then get stuck, or it might be injured by the roach's struggle. Some toads will reflexively strike at oversized prey due to predatory instinct, but the strike doesn't mean the prey is appropriate.

Signs of Overfeeding and Underfeeding

Overfeeding signs: The toad's body becomes noticeably swollen or bloated, with a distended abdomen. The toad appears sluggish and moves less than usual, resting more often. Behavior changes—the normally active forager becomes sedentary. The toad may refuse food for several days after overeating. In severe cases, the toad shows signs of impaction: straining to defecate, loss of appetite, or inability to move properly. Skin texture may appear stretched or shiny from abdominal distension.

Underfeeding signs: The toad's body appears thin or angular rather than rounded. Movement becomes hyperactive or frantic as the toad searches for food. The toad loses condition over weeks; weight loss is visible. Juveniles show slowed growth. The toad may attempt to escape the enclosure more frequently (stress-seeking behavior). Eyes may appear slightly sunken.

Fire-bellied toads are active enough that their normal behavior makes underfeeding easier to spot than overfeeding. A well-fed fire-bellied toad is active, alert, and interactive. An underfed one is either hyperactive (searching for food) or lethargic (energy conservation), with visible thin appearance.

Breeding Season and Appetite Changes

During breeding season (typically spring to early summer in wild populations), male fire-bellied toads become more territorial and vocal. They're also more active and more likely to feed. A male in breeding condition might eat slightly more frequently than during non-breeding months. This isn't cause for alarm; it's a natural metabolic increase supporting the energy demands of territorial defense and vocalizing. Accommodate by feeding the same portion but slightly more often (5 times per week instead of 4, for example).

Female fire-bellied toads preparing to breed may show increased appetite as their bodies prepare to generate eggs. A gravid female (carrying eggs) might eat noticeably more. The goal is to support egg production without pushing the toad into obesity. Increase feeding frequency rather than portion size—slightly more frequent feedings at standard portions prevents both underfeeding and overfeeding.

Post-breeding or post-egg-laying, appetite may drop briefly as the female recovers. This is normal and requires no intervention beyond maintaining standard feeding schedules. Within a week or two, appetite returns to normal.

Captive fire-bellied toads in climate-controlled environments without seasonal cues may not experience strong breeding seasonality. This is fine; maintain consistent feeding throughout the year. Only keepers attempting to breed their toads or those who've observed natural seasonal appetite swings need to adjust for breeding season.

Supplementation Recommendations for Fire-Bellied Toads

Fire-bellied toads require adequate calcium and vitamin A, just like larger amphibians. Discoid roaches gut-loaded with nutritious vegetation provide a solid micronutrient baseline. However, supplementation via dusting is still beneficial, particularly for growing juveniles and breeding females. Dust small roaches with calcium-vitamin D3 powder roughly once monthly, using the same technique as with larger amphibians: place roaches in a small container, add a pinch of powder, shake gently, and offer immediately. The powder adheres to the roach and is consumed when the toad feeds.

For fire-bellied toads, avoid excessive dusting. Once monthly is appropriate; dusting more frequently risks vitamin D3 accumulation and toxicity.
